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Support policy for OData libraries #315

Closed
wants to merge 4 commits into from

Conversation

habbes
Copy link
Contributor

@habbes habbes commented Jul 2, 2024

Add support policy document.

Copy link
Contributor

Learn Build status updates of commit ce5652e:

✅ Validation status: passed

File Status Preview URL Details
Odata-docs/support/support-policy.md ✅Succeeded View
Odata-docs/TOC.yml ✅Succeeded View

For more details, please refer to the build report.

For any questions, please:

Copy link
Contributor

Learn Build status updates of commit 93216bd:

✅ Validation status: passed

File Status Preview URL Details
Odata-docs/support/support-policy.md ✅Succeeded View
Odata-docs/TOC.yml ✅Succeeded View

For more details, please refer to the build report.

For any questions, please:


Microsoft.AspNetCore 8.x is currently actively supported. It supports .NET 5 and later and OData.NET 7.x.

Microsoft.AspNetCore 7.x is currently actively supports. It supports .NET Framework 4.5 and later and .NET 5 and later. It supports OData.NET 7.x. It will enter maintenance mode soon.
Copy link
Contributor

@ElizabethOkerio ElizabethOkerio Jul 29, 2024

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Suggested change
Microsoft.AspNetCore 7.x is currently actively supports. It supports .NET Framework 4.5 and later and .NET 5 and later. It supports OData.NET 7.x. It will enter maintenance mode soon.
Microsoft.AspNetCore 7.x is currently actively supported but will enter maintenance mode soon. It supports .NET Framework 4.5 and later and .NET 5 and later. It supports OData.NET 7.x.

Copy link
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

The table below says that this is already in maintenance mode. I'm not sure why here you're saying it'll enter maintenance mode soon. This doc also doesn't give exact dates of when things will happen. I believe we already have these dates and the doc should be updated to reflect that.

Copy link
Contributor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

The table below refers to AspNet.OData, which is technically a different package from AspNetCore.OData. Alt hough they share codebase. The doc only specifies exact dates for cases where there is consensus on the dates. I'm not sure whether there was an official announce,ent of AspNet.OData going into maintenance mode.

Copy link
Contributor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

That said, I think both should be in maintenance mode. But we get occasional feature requests on both.


| Version | Original release date | Latest patch version | Latest patch release date | Support phase | End of support |
| ------------|-----------------------|-----------------------|---------------------------|---------------|----------------|
| 8.x | TBD | 8.0.0-preview-3 | 2024-05-31 | Preview | TBD |
Copy link
Contributor

@ElizabethOkerio ElizabethOkerio Jul 29, 2024

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Should this table be updated with the correct dates?

Copy link
Contributor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

I'm wondering whether we should keep this these dates in the table.

Copy link
Contributor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

I've updated the RC release date though.


| Version | OData.NET version | Original release date | Latest patch version | Latest patch release date | Support phase | End of support |
| ------------|-------------------|-----------------------|-----------------------|---------------------------|---------------|----------------|
| 1.x | 7.x and 8.x | 2020-09-02 | 1.0.9 | 2022-06-10 | Maintenance | 2025-06-27 |
Copy link
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Will there be another release for this library once we end support for it? Should it be indicated here?

Copy link
Contributor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

I think this should still be in active support.

Copy link
Contributor

Learn Build status updates of commit 03e51c8:

✅ Validation status: passed

File Status Preview URL Details
Odata-docs/support/support-policy.md ✅Succeeded View
Odata-docs/TOC.yml ✅Succeeded View

For more details, please refer to the build report.

For any questions, please:

@habbes
Copy link
Contributor Author

habbes commented Sep 26, 2024

Support policy already merged with ODL 8 release notes PR.

@habbes habbes closed this Sep 26,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ants